Are you planning a trip from Copenhagen, Denmark to the picturesque landscapes of New Zealand? While the distance between these two destinations may seem daunting, with careful planning and a few travel tips, you can ensure a smooth journey from one corner of the globe to the other. Flights from Copenhagen to New Zealand typically involve multiple layovers, with common stopover locations including major hubs like Dubai, Singapore, or Hong Kong. When booking your flights, consider factors such as total travel time, layover durations, and potential visa requirements for each transit country. One of the key considerations when traveling such a long distance is jet lag. Crossing multiple time zones can disrupt your sleep patterns and leave you feeling fatigued upon arrival. To minimize the effects of jet lag, try adjusting your sleep schedule a few days before your trip to align more closely with your destination's time zone. Stay hydrated, get plenty of rest during your flight, and consider using natural remedies like melatonin to help regulate your sleep. Another important aspect to consider when traveling to New Zealand from Denmark is the weather. While Denmark experiences cold winters and mild summers, New Zealand's climate varies significantly from north to south and can change rapidly due to its geographical diversity. Be prepared for all types of weather by packing layers, a waterproof jacket, sturdy walking shoes, and sunscreen to protect yourself from New Zealand's strong UV rays. Upon arrival in New Zealand, you may encounter differences in currency, transportation, and local customs. Make sure to have some New Zealand dollars on hand for immediate expenses and familiarize yourself with the country's public transportation options, such as buses, trains, or rental cars, to get around easily. Lastly, don't forget to obtain travel insurance that covers any unexpected medical emergencies, flight cancellations, or lost luggage. Traveling long distances poses its own set of challenges, and having the right insurance can provide peace of mind in case of any unforeseen circumstances.
